    Food: 4 Service: 4 Ambience: 4 Date/Time: 10/1/2023 12:30pm Order: custom bowl Crowd: only 1 other table occupied After 2 failed food businesses, this semi-fast food restaurant looks like it may survive. The variety of items offered is plentiful and diverse. The only thing that would be advantageous to a new customer is a set of bowl and pita combos to give the customer a start on what FRESKO considers a tasty mix. The service is quick since they are just putting into the bowl/pita the items you select. The hummus is good but has a little grainy texture to it. Your bowl comes with 1/2 a pita sliced in 2. They offer a spinach rice and yellow rice along with lentils. The chicken and lamb were good but the lamb was a little over cooked. The place itself was set up nicely with a long bench along the left wall with tables spaced along it and chairs on the other side. Also had some similar tables on the right. Overall the food is good and would definitely recommend it.

    Fresko is a excellent choice for healthier Mediterranean meals. I was famished and in the mood for Greek so I decided on the Build Your Own Bowl. I chose falafel and chicken as my protein, the spinach rice, added cucumbers, roasted red pepper, pickled onion, Kalamata olives, banana peppers and spicy feta, olive oil & cilantro as my sauce. This was the most flavorful, rich bowl I've had. I ordered the lemon soup but it wasn't authentic. Everything was perfection and plated well. My daughter enjoyed spanakopita (spinach pie) and loved it. It was her first time trying it. I will absolutely return again for a meal. Delicious !

    The restaurant is really clean and the staff was extremely kind in helping me figure out what to order. The concept is like Chipotle- you pick your bowl, choice of rice, protein and add ons. I built a bowl with two types of rice (lemon and spinach), chicken, red peppers, hummus, cucumber salad, tzatziki and lemon tahini dressing. The pita comes with it and it was fresh and tasty. The bowl is $11 or so and the ingredients were very fresh. Thank you for helping me with the choices and great service!

    I LOVE Greek food and have tried dozens of places and this is by far my new favorite quick-bite place to go. It's a very similar set up to cava but there are more options and the best part is getting 2 proteins in a bowl or gyro for no extra charge. The portion size was amazing and everything tasted great. There is a large varieties of different toppings. This trip I didn't try any of the desserts but they have baklava and baklava cheesecake a staff member recommended I will be trying next time for sure. They also have greek topping French fries that sounded delicious. The staff is super friendly and inviting and the business is incredibly clean. I highly recommend!

    Stopped in at the new FRESKO last night. They're another build-your-own bowl operation with a strictly greek focus. I liked the idea in theory but I found the ordering process to be overwhelming as a first time customer. I would probably get the hang of it as a repeat customer but their are a ton of options to pick from. I liked all the things I added to my bowl, especially the spicy hummus (which wasn't spicy as much as flavorful), falafel, and olives. I found the bar behind the gladd where they were prepping food to be a bit messy for such a small crowd. I also found the portions to be a bit small for the price. There's plenty of seating inside or you can get your food to-go.
